• Before booking a holiday, we should carefully read and understand the terms and conditions of the contract of sale.

• As consumers we may claim compensation if the information provided on the holiday results false or misleading.

• Upon booking a holiday, we should always purchase a travel insurance policy.

• If our holiday is changed significantly before the date of departure we may opt to cancel it and claim a refund.

• If the holiday is not as advertised and agreed to, we should complain immediately.
